如何检查 Linux 编码历史记录

如何检查 Linux 编码历史记录

有没有办法跟踪操作系统字符集(编码)的变化,例如,假设字符集在本月之前是 UTF8,现在是拉丁语?

答案1

这种改变很少会留下审计痕迹。这在某种程度上是可以做到的,但你必须创造性地制定审计政策并进行一些推断。也就是说,这并不容易,而且不会给你一条清晰的locale changed审计线索。

如果您想查看这种情况是否曾经发生在尚未配置为捕获此类事件的系统上,那么您很不走运。

答案2

字符集通常特定于应用程序和文件。就底层 GNU/Linux 系统而言,它只是字节序列。

您在全局范围内能找到的最接近的东西可能是您的语言环境。当前设置可通过命令访问locale。实现永久全局语言环境更改的方法是特定于发行版的。

/etc/fstab 中大多数文件系统还有挂载选项,用于将文件名编码更改为 UTF8。

相关内容